Pearls of Wisdom
Pearls of Wisdom is an installation by Studio Kmzero + ZetaFonts (Debora Manetti, Cosimo Lorenzo Pancini, Francesco Canovaro + Barbara Giardelli) with Simone Massoni (SketchThisOut), Ilaria Falorsi, Jonathan Calugi (HappyLoversTown), Leonardo Betti (LeonardoWorx), Federico Landini (I depend on me), Riccardo Sabatini e Linda Cavallini (Lia).

What better way to envision the concept of “glocal” than choosing the lovely florentine hills as a backdrop for a graduation show of the students of the Master in Communication Design at Central Saint Martins College of Art and Design in London?
With the project Pearls of Wisdom (Perle di Saggezza) Studio Kmzero expands on the idea of mixing local and global, by inviting a selection of tuscan visual artists and illustrators to visualize quotations from influential personalities of worldwide communication design. The result will be available in art capsules, contained in the vending machine “Pearls of Wisdom” that will be active during the event, next to an installation of generative graphics, in which quotations are interpreted using fonts from the digital foundry ZetaFonts (www.zetafonts.com).

Digital Fabrics
Conference by Riccardo Marchesi & Troy Robert Nachtigall
Sunday, July 8th 2012
Location: Pensione Bencistà
Duration: 4:30 pm to 6:30 pm
How will we interact with computers embedded in the objects that will surround us in the future, to achieve the Internet of Things? One of the possible solutions is a communication throught interactive fabrics, able to exchange data between a computer and the outer world. 70% of our body area is covered by fabrics, and in our homes there are many textiles, bed sheets, curtains, upholstery. Riccardo Marchesi, founder of plugandwear.com and Troy Robert Nachtigall, american designer expert of wearable computing will talk about the latest frontiers of this technology. Participants will be able to touch some of the most advanced developments available today.
